#1) Choose the Right Wood

Wood significantly impacts flavor!

  • Mild woods like cherry and apple are perfect for poultry, pork, and fish.
  • Medium woods like hickory and oak are great for beef and pork.
  • Mesquite is the strongest wood offering the strongest flavor. Usually best with beef.

You can mix and match, but don't overdo it. A little bit of wood goes a long way.

#2) Keep Temperatures Consistent

Consistency is the key to tender, flavorful meat.

Your Lone Star Grill is designed with thick carbon steel walls to aid with this, but you also need how to learn how to manage your vents to control airflow and maintain a steady temperature.

By the same token, you should avoid opening the lid too frequently.

#3) Learn to Love the Rub

A good rub adds a flavorful bark to your meat and adds depth of flavor. Start with a simple base: salt, pepper, and garlic powder. Then, layer on new flavors and spices. Don't be afraid to experiment!

Whatever spices you choose, apply the rub generously and allow it to sit on the meat for several hours. You can even try letting your rub marinate your meat overnight to maximize flavor penetration.

#4) Keep Meat Moist

Meat can dry out during long cooks. Spritzing it with apple cider vinegar, apple juice, or water every 45 to 60 minutes after the first few hours of smoking can enjoy that tender, juicy flavor.

#5) Let it Rest

It's crucial to let your meat rest! Wrap it loosely in foil or butcher paper and let it rest 3 minutes to 2 hours depending on the size of the cut. Believe it or not your meat is still cooking during this time as the internal temperature will rise slightly during rest. Meanwhile, the juices will redistribute throughout the meat.

Cut too soon, and all that juice floods out of your meat and onto your cutting service, which means your guests don't get them!
